CVE-2018-19589

Exp

Incorrect Access Controls of Security Officer (SO) in PKCS11 R2 provider that ships with the Utimaco CryptoServer HSM product package allows an SO authenticated to a slot to retrieve attributes of keys marked as private keys in external key storage, and also delete keys marked as private keys in external key storage. This compromises the availability of all keys configured with external key storage and may result in an economic attack in which the attacker denies legitimate users access to keys while maintaining possession of an encrypted copy (blob) of the external key store for ransom. This attack has been dubbed reverse ransomware attack and may be executed via a physical connection to the CryptoServer or remote connection if SSH or remote access to LAN CryptoServer has been compromised. The Confidentiality and Integrity of the affected keys, however, remain untarnished.
